The Fundación Tres Culturas is once again celebrating the diversity of cultures with a film series dedicated to highlighting what is different and promoting everything that helps us to understand the need for diversity as part of the common heritage of humanity.
Film has the power to illustrate different ways of living, understanding and participating in the world, bringing new perspectives and also different ways of resolving conflicts. Cultural diversity thus contributes to the solution of common problems and the search for creative answers to the main conflicts of Humanity, mainly those related to peace and solidarity.
This cycle is part of the celebration of May as Cultural Diversity Month, given that Friday 21 is World Day for Cultural Diversity for Dialogue and Development, which promotes peaceful and enriching coexistence among all the peoples that inhabit the planet.
The films and documentaries proposed in this cycle open the doors to beautiful landscapes and distant languages in order to highlight the value of human interrelation, the key to peaceful coexistence and to a shared social future.

A family affair (Manbiki kazoku). Hirokazu Koreeda. Japan, 2018, 121 min.
Osamu and his son find a little girl in the street, freezing cold. At first, his wife does not want her to stay with them, but ends up taking pity on the little girl. Despite struggling to survive on petty theft, the family is happy. Until an unforeseen incident reveals a secret that tests the ties that bind them together.
Awards 2018
Oscar Awards: Nominated for Best Foreign Language Film
Cannes Film Festival: Palme d'Or (Best Film)
Golden Globes: Best Foreign Language Film nominee
BAFTA Awards: Nominated for Best Foreign Language Film
Los Angeles Film Critics Association: Best Foreign Film
